CHOCOLATE-CHIP BANANA BREAD

Stuff You Need
3 super-ripe bananas (the mushier, the better)
1 1/2 cups flour
1 cup sugar
1/2 tsp baking soda
Dash of salt
1 egg
1/2 stick butter
1/2 cup chocolate chips
Cooking spray

Equipment You Need
Loaf pan
Large bowl
Fork or potato masher
Small microwave safe bowl
Stirring spoon or spatula
Measuring cup
Measuring spoons


Preheat oven to 325 degrees. Grease a loaf pan with cooking spray. (Here's a cooking spray tip: the drops from the spay will make the floor very, very slippery so always spray over the sink.)


Peel and mash the bananas in a large bowl. Add flour, sugar, baking soda, salt, and egg.


Melt butter in microwave and add it to bowl. Stir all of the stuff together until it is mixed up.


Pour the batter in greased loaf pan and sprinkle on the chocolate chips. If you absolutely love chocolate like my sisters do, add a few more chips. Bake for 60-70 minutes until a toothpick put in the middle of the loaf comes out without any gunk on it.

Try Banana Bon-Bons. Super yummy!

1 Banana
1 Jar of Peanut Butter
1 cup Chocolate Chips
Whipped Cream (optional)

Saucepan
Paper Towels
Freezer-Safe Plate
Toothpicks

1. Cut up the banana into somewhat thin slices
2. Melt the chocolate chips in the saucepan
3. Put one toothpick into each banana slice.
4. Using the toothpick, dip each banana into the chocolate
5. Put paper towels on the plate
6. After dipping, put each banana on the plate.
7. Remove toothpicks.
8. Let slices freeze.
9. Get slices out of freezer and smear each with PB.
10. Add a dollop of whipped cream if you want and enjoy!
